Which Random Player is Better? R14: Christian Hubicki vs Mike Holloway by Ill_Anxiety_1412 in survivorponderosa

[–]Ground-flyer 21 points22 points  (0 children)

Mike by far, I think he is one of the most underrated players by far. Most people say he made a big blunder at the auction, but the quick on the spot thinking to not give his money for the letters was the correct decision as the others were already going to target him. If he went through it would be one of the greatest moves ever. Besides that Mike was I think the best challenge beast in survivor and found an idol even though Joe had the clue. He also had lots of control during the merge, chose the correct people to go against in the final and almost pulled a Hail Mary when he said he would play his idol for shirin. He was a good player that can defend his threat level with imunity wins

What's the best strategic move of the New Era Survivor (41-49)? by noobzapper21 in survivorponderosa

[–]Ground-flyer 39 points40 points  (0 children)

I think it is Dee voting out Julie and telling Julie to play her idol. It makes Julie this big threat which protects herself in future votes, it makes the drew blindside vote out so much easier because they all think Dee will be working with them. And she waits to reveal it at FTC which makes Austin look like a fool. That move won her the game!
